Output 81e689313adaf2221da0a21f1da9d61200854877b5aa6ce7ffd649c0ef57eca3:2

value
175800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eff494f89666c8f275283599d1d6eeb65a841ec OP_EQUAL
address
3Bov5FdUvnYZyP97P1ySWJpDGveRuh5YfE
transaction
81e689313adaf2221da0a21f1da9d61200854877b5aa6ce7ffd649c0ef57eca3
spent
true